Abstract
Background: Age at menarche (AAM) marks the formal beginning of sexual maturation in girls. Present study focuses on determining the AAM among Tibetan girls and its association with socio-economic status (SES) and physical activity level. Materials and Methods: This study was conducted on 276 Tibetan adolescent girls (13 to 18 years) in Kangra district of Himachal Pradesh. Data was collected using a proforma, consisting of questions regarding socio-demographic profile, AAM and physical activity level (PAQ-A). Data was entered in MS-Excel and analyzed in SPSS 20.0. Results: Early menarche was observed in majority of girls with most frequent AAM as 13 years for the sample. A significant difference of AAM categories was found with SES and level of physical activity. Conclusion: Girls who were in better socio-economic category and were physically more active attained menarche at an earlier age in comparison to others.
